Although mobile phones started being used in the 1980s, it’s only in the last ten years that they have become popular and now they allow us to do so many things (such as take pictures, receive calls and texts, go on the internet, listen to music and play games) that it hardly seems worth carrying anything other than the mobile and our wallets. While this has been fantastic for us, it hasn’t worked out so well for the home phone, as landlines are becoming less important and a lot of people are either disconnecting their landline or barely using it and paying for the privilege.

It might seem like there is no need to keep a landline any longer - why bother when we can do everything through our mobiles? Well, the network can be a problem. You don’t always get fantastic signal wherever you are and the same goes for whoever’s calling you if they’re also on their mobile. This doesn’t happen with a landline, and it’s a good thing as well - imagine if there was an emergency that happened at home but you couldn’t find any signal to call for help. ... that there is still a place for a home phone line in our lives, no matter how often or little you use it.

Fortunately, you can get a phone line installed and connected for a very affordable fee – long gone are the days when only the rich and famous could afford to install a landline. Almost every major broadband provider also provides a landline service to customers, with a common catch being that landlines can often now only be purchased in conjunction with the company’s broadband. However, there are certain providers, usually the bigger ones like BT and Virgin, who do offer a landline on its own if that’s what the customer wants. BT, in particular, was one of the first of the country’s home phone providers and still offers one of the wider ranges of landline options available. It has four landline-only deals which are aimed at those who use the landline in varying amounts: the Unlimited Weekend Calls deal, the Unlimited Weekend and Evening Calls deal, the Unlimited Anytime Calls deal and the Unlimited Anytime Plan Plus deal. All of the deals run for twelve months and are fairly self-explanatory in what they offer – they are all available for a flat line rental fee with calls at the times specified in their names thrown in free. The difference between the Unlimited Anytime and Unlimited Anytime Plan Plus deals is simply that the latter includes cheaper calls to UK mobiles as well as unlimited calls to landlines at any time.

There is still a place in our lives for a landline and it’s probably the easiest and cheapest it’s ever been to get one - unlike searching for broadband and TV deals, it shouldn’t take long to find a landline deal you’re happy with.
